I'm not sure if you meet the same issue with me. But if same, first you could turn up the number of backup slots in game setting, so you could get more than one slots for backup. Once they reach the limit, go save folder and delete the older manually before saving.
The path should be:

C:\Users\XXXX\AppData\LocalLow\Lafrontier\Elin\Save\Backup\world X
You'll find the backup id as folders so you can remove it you wanna drop.

I have no idea why game has issue when remove empty folder (it removed files well) for me, It should work fine for the past few days (or updates), However if I delete by myself in folder then it work fine, although a little annoying to me before fixed.
Ronnie Nov 24, 2024 @ 9:07am 
Well, I may found the cause of failed deleting in my case. I use the google drive to sync my saves between PCs for cloud saving. It may cause some of save path bug in game. After I remove the google drive desktop and restart the PC then readjust the number of backup slots, it seems work fine to create new backup now.
